Q: Why do you focus on Google search engine results? What about other search engines, like Bing and Yahoo?
A: Statistics show that over 65 percent of all searches conducted on the internet are made using Google, so it makes good business sense to focus on that marketplace. The other 35 percent of searches is split between Bing and Yahoo.

Q: How long does it take to convert our existing website to one that is mobile device capable?
A: For a existing website the time to add mobile detection and response typically takes 5 to 7 business days. We will need to have access to your IT person or whomever is responsible for the technical aspect of your website.
